import cv2
import os
import tkinter as tk
from tkinter import filedialog, messagebox
# Character mappings
char_to_num = {chr(i): i for i in range(255)}
num_to_char = {i: chr(i) for i in range(255)}
# Function to encrypt an image
def encrypt_image(image_path, message, secret_key):
img = cv2.imread(image_path)
if img is None:
messagebox.showerror("Error", "Could not read the image.")
return
n, m, z = 0, 0, 0
# Store the message length in the first pixel
img[n, m, z] = len(message)
m += 1 # Move to the next pixel
# Store the Secret Key in the image
for char in secret_key:
img[n, m, z] = char_to_num.get(char, 32) # Store ASCII values
n += 1
m += 1
z = (z + 1) % 3
# Store the message in the image
for char in message:
img[n, m, z] = char_to_num.get(char, 32) # Store ASCII values
n += 1
m += 1
z = (z + 1) % 3
output_path = "encryptedImage.png"
cv2.imwrite(output_path, img)
messagebox.showinfo("Success", f"Message encrypted and saved as '{output_path}'")
os.system(f"start {output_path}") # Open the encrypted image
# Function to decrypt an image
def decrypt_image(image_path, entered_key):
img = cv2.imread(image_path)
if img is None:
messagebox.showerror("Error", "Could not read the image.")
return
n, m, z = 0, 0, 0
# Retrieve message length
message_length = img[n, m, z]
m += 1 # Move to the next pixel
# Retrieve stored Secret Key
extracted_key = ""
for _ in range(len(entered_key)): # Assume the key length is known
extracted_key += num_to_char.get(img[n, m, z], "?")
n += 1
m += 1
z = (z + 1) % 3
# Check if entered key matches the stored key
if extracted_key != entered_key:
messagebox.showerror("Error", "Invalid Secret Key! Decryption failed.")
return
# Extract the message
extracted_message = ""
for _ in range(message_length):
extracted_message += num_to_char.get(img[n, m, z], "?")
n += 1
m += 1
z = (z + 1) % 3
messagebox.showinfo("Decryption Successful", f"Message: {extracted_message}")
# Function to hide a file inside an image
def encrypt_image_with_file(image_path, file_path, output_path="encryptedImage.png"):
img = cv2.imread(image_path)
if img is None:
messagebox.showerror("Error", "Could not read the image.")
return
# Get total available pixels in the image
total_pixels = img.shape[0] * img.shape[1] * 3 # Height * Width * 3 (RGB channels)
# Read file data as bytes
with open(file_path, "rb") as f:
file_data = f.read()
# Convert file data to binary
binary_data = ''.join(format(byte, '08b') for byte in file_data)
file_size = len(binary_data)
# Check if file size fits in the image
if file_size + 16 > total_pixels: # +16 for storing file size
messagebox.showerror("Error", "File too large for this image! Use a bigger image.")
return
n, m, z = 0, 0, 0
# Store file size in the first few pixels (16 bits)
img[n, m, z] = file_size & 255 # First byte
img[n, m + 1, z] = (file_size >> 8) & 255 # Second byte
m += 2
# Embed file data in image pixels
for bit in binary_data:
img[n, m, z] = (img[n, m, z] & ~1) | int(bit) # Modify LSB
n += 1
if n >= img.shape[0]: # Move to next row
n = 0
m += 1
if m >= img.shape[1]: # If end of row, move to next channel
m = 0
z = (z + 1) % 3
if z >= 3:
messagebox.showerror("Error", "Unexpected overflow while hiding data.")
return
cv2.imwrite(output_path, img)
messagebox.showinfo("Success", f"File hidden successfully in {output_path}")
# Function to extract a hidden file from an image
def decrypt_file_from_image(image_path, output_file="extracted_file.bin"):
img = cv2.imread(image_path)
if img is None:
messagebox.showerror("Error", "Could not read the image.")
return
n, m, z = 0, 0, 0
# Extract file size from the first two pixels (16 bits)
file_size = img[n, m, z] | (img[n, m + 1, z] << 8)
m += 2
total_pixels = img.shape[0] * img.shape[1] * 3 # Total available bits
# Validate if file size fits within the image
if file_size > total_pixels:
messagebox.showerror("Error", "File size is too large for this image! Decryption failed.")
return
binary_data = ""
for _ in range(file_size):
binary_data += str(img[n, m, z] & 1) # Extract LSB
n += 1
if n >= img.shape[0]: # Move to next row
n = 0
m += 1
if m >= img.shape[1]: # If end of row, move to next channel
m = 0
z = (z + 1) % 3
if z >= 3:
messagebox.showerror("Error", "Unexpected overflow while extracting data.")
return
# Convert binary data back to bytes
file_data = bytearray(int(binary_data[i:i+8], 2) for i in range(0, len(binary_data), 8))
with open(output_file, "wb") as f:
f.write(file_data)
messagebox.showinfo("Success", f"File extracted successfully as {output_file}")
